How to install and configure java in Linux
Download Java package or Java source for Linux from Java homepage. There is a Java RPM package for Redhat-based distributions. Choose that if you are using Fedora Linux or other Redhat-based Linux distributions. If you are using Slackware Linux, choose the Linux (self-extracting file). See the screenshot example below:
When the download is finished, copy the Java file to the /usr/local/src directory or whatever directory you choose to install third party software in your Linux system.
root@slacker:~# cp /home/luzar/Desktop/jre-6u12-linux-i586.bin
/usr/local/src/
The Java file does not have execute permission by default. So, to extract Java, give execute permission like the example below:
root@slacker:/usr/local/src# ls -l total 19728 -rw-r--r-- 1 luzar users 20168773 2009-03-11 21:42 jre-6u12-linux-i586.bin drwxr-xr-x 7 root root 4096 2008-10-13 03:48 vmware-tools-distrib/ root@slacker:/usr/local/src# chmod a+x jre-6u12-linux-i586.bin root@slacker:/usr/local/src# ls -l total 19728 -rwxr-xr-x 1 luzar users 20168773 2009-03-11 21:42 jre-6u12-linux-i586.bin* drwxr-xr-x 7 root root 4096 2008-10-13 03:48 vmware-tools-distrib/ root@slacker:/usr/local/src#
Now we can extract Java file by running the command below:
root@slacker:/usr/local/src# ./jre-6u12-linux-i586.bin
Read the license agreement and press space bar to move to the next screen. At the bottom of the license agreement you need to answer yes to agree to the terms and install the software.
Do you agree to the above license terms? [yes or no]
yes
It only takes a few seconds to extract the Java file. When it's done, we can start configure Java for our Linux system.
Configure Java in Mozilla Firefox
Change directory to the /usr/lib/firefox/plugins. If your firefox directory has version number, than provide that version number.
root@slacker:/usr/local/src# cd /usr/lib/firefox-3.0.6/plugins/ root@slacker:/usr/lib/firefox-3.0.6/plugins# ls libnullplugin.so* root@slacker:/usr/lib/firefox-3.0.6/plugins#
In firefox 'plugins' directory, create a symbolic link to the Java installation directory. See the example below:
root@slacker:/usr/lib/firefox-3.0.6/plugins# ln -s /usr/local/src/jre1.6.0_12
/plugin/i386/ns7/libjavaplugin_oji.so . root@slacker:/usr/lib/firefox-3.0.6/plugins# ls libjavaplugin_oji.so@ libnullplugin.so* root@slacker:/usr/lib/firefox-3.0.6/plugins#
Open firefox and click Tools menu, then choose Add-ons. Click plugins tab to confirm that Java Console is there. See an example screenshot below:
